gb_proxy: extend TLV parser In BSSGP RIM the routing information IE is appearing twice (source and destination). The current one dimensional TLV parsing method would only give us access to the first routing information IE (destination), so lets increase the dimension to 2, so that we get also IEs that appear twice. osmo-gbproxy is a proxy for the Gb interface within the 3GPP GERAN (GPRS/EDGE RAN) architecture. It is part of the Osmocom Open Source Mobile Communications projects.
It allows you to aggregate many Gb links/connections into one. It also has the ability to convert between different Gb interface protocol stacking, such as from Gb-over-FrameRelay to Gb-over-IP.
Until 2021 it used to be part of the osmo-sgsn git repository, and before that (until 2017) part of openbsc.git
